ECON0013-1

National Income Accounting and practical exercises


Duration :30h Th, 15h Pr
Credits/ECTS :
2nd year of a Bachelor's degree in economical sciences4
2nd "candidature" in economical sciences6
required preliminary complement to register in the "licence" in economical sciences6
Holder(s) :Fabienne Fecher‑Bourgeois
Course contents : Introduction to the European system of National Accounts

Gross Domestic Product computation : value added, expenditure and incomes perspectives

Uses of National Accounts : international and temporal comparisons

Input-Output analysis

Seminars presented by students : varied economic issues based on SEC95 concepts.

Seminars topics : public authorities budget, retirements, health expenditure, environment, underground economy, developing countries, regional economy, state-owned companies,...
